She is the author of two other poetry books, Echoes from the Heart and Waiting for Spring, published in 1995 and 1997.
Several of Grace’s poems have been set to music and performed by choral singers, church choirs and folk singers. It was an honour for her when “Keepers of the Light” was performed for Her Majesty, Queen Elizabeth II and “One Fleeting Moment” by the Elmer Iseler Singers. Another honour was having “Walking Into Death” included in the Royal Newfoundland Regimental booklet.
